Abstract

A new miniature DMFC system that includes a fuel cell stack, a fuel tank and a passive ancillary system (termed “thermal-fluids management system” in this paper) is presented. The thermal-fluids management system utilizes passive approaches for fuel storage and delivery, air breathing, water management, CO2 release and thermal management. With 5.1 g of neat methanol in the fuel cartridge, a prototype has successfully demonstrated 18 h of continuous operation with total power output of 1.56 Wh.
